How much does it cost to rent an apartment in King George?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| King George Studio Apartments | $1,812 | $1,812 | $1,812 |
| King George 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,874 | $1,150 | $3,829 |
| King George 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,173 | $1,250 | $5,865 |
| King George 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,462 | $1,550 | $4,062 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ly King George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ly King George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in King George is $2,083.
What is the largest Pet Friendly King George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in King George is a 1,350 square feet unit starting from $1,754 at Aquia.
What is the average size for King George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in King George is currently at 723 sq ft.
